India Achieves 40 Percent Non-Fossil Based Installed Power Capacity With Over 150 GW Renewable Energy
At the 2015 United Nations Climate Change Conference held in Paris, as part of its Nationally Determined Contributions (NDCs), India had committed to achieving 40 per cent of its installed electricity capacity from non-fossil energy sources by 2030. . Supreme Court: No Total Ban On Use Of Firecrackers, Fireworks Containing Barium Salts Prohibited
The Supreme Court Friday clarified that there is no total ban on the use of firecrackers and only those fireworks which contain Barium salts are prohibited. A bench of Justices M R Shah and A S Bopanna said however that no authority can be permitted… Read More

Women Will Be Inducted In NDA For Permanent Commission, Centre Tells Supreme Court
In a historic moment for Indian women defence personnel, the Centre has informed the Supreme Court that the three services chiefs have agreed to give permanent commission and allow their entry into the NDA. . SC Refuses Interim Protection To Ex-Maharashtra HM Anil Deshmukh In Money Laundering Case
On Monday, the Supreme Court refused to grant any interim protection for coercive action to former Maharashtra Home Minister Anil Deshmukh in a money laundering case registered by the Enforcement Directorate (ED). .
